Author Bio

Erin Gough is a fiction writer living on Gadigal land in Sydney, whose award-winning work has been published globally. She is the author of three books for young adults: The Flywheel, which won the Ampersand Prize, Amelia Westlake, winner of the Readings Young Adult Book Prize and the NSW Premier’s Ethel Turner Prize for Young Adult Fiction, and Into the Mouth of the Wolf, published in May 2024. Erin’s novella for adults, Distance, was a winner of the Griffith Review Novella Project. Her short fiction has been published in many journals and anthologies, including Kindred: 12 Queer #LoveOzYA Stories, The Age, Best Australian Stories and New Australian Fiction.

Erin’s writing navigates contemporary themes with lyricism, humour and charm. Her talks focus on the importance of reading diversely and learning how to tell your individual story. Her workshops explore the craft of storytelling.
